There is a new defensive coordinator for the Dallas Cowboys.

They needed an experienced replacement for Dan Quinn, who was departing to join the Washington Commanders,

their divisional rivals.

They went for Mike Zimmer, one of the top defensive minds on the market, for this reason.

Notably, Michael Irvin, a former Cowboys legend, is ecstatic about this hire.

In an interview with Undisputed, the Hall of Famer reflected on his three decades ago as a defensive backs coach for

the Cowboys.

Irvin declared, “I truly do think this is a great hire.”

He discussed how Zimmer brought intensity to practice every day and how the DBs were always prepared to play.

The great wide receiver thinks that the Cowboys needed this defense more than anything else since he thought Dan

Quinn’s squad wasn’t always prepared, which clearly came back to bite them when it counted most.

Irvin wasn’t overly sad when Quinn departed the team because he had already been critical of him. Before Quinn’s

three years, the Cowboys possessed a strong pass defense and a talented pass-rushing unit, but they were never able

to pull through when it mattered most of the season.
